A story about the end of the world... or is it? After an apocalyptic event, survivors struggle to make sense of their world while awaiting a rescue that may never come. They band together in hopes of discovering a community, but each step they take leads them into more danger. When things take a turn for the worst, they start to suspect that the deck has been deliberately stacked against them
